- Scientific name
- Antaresia papuensis Esquerré, Donnellan, Pavón-Vázquez, Fenker & Keogh, 2021
- Common name
- Papuan spotted python
- Type reference
- Esquerré, D., Donnellan, S.C., Pavón-Vázquez, C.J., Fenker, J. & Keogh, J.S. (2021). Phylogeography, historical demography and systematics of the world’s smallest pythons (Pythonidae, Antaresia). Molecular Phylogenetics and Evolution, 161, 107181
- WildNet taxon ID
- 36771
- Synonym(s)
- Antaresia maculosa
- Nature Conservation Act 1992 (NCA) status
- Least concern
- Conservation significant
- No
- Endemicity
- Native
- Pest status
- Nil
